The friendly and welcoming Gifford House has free parking and is about 1.25 miles south of Princes Street and on a main bus route to central Edinburgh. Gifford House is on off highway A7, but is quiet and peaceful in the back. Back bedrooms enjoy superb views towards Salisbury Crags and Arthur's Seat. The Victorian house serves a full Scottish breakfast and offers a good breakfast menu. The rooms are of a high standard and have free Wi-Fi. There are many golf courses close to Gifford House, and Holyrood Park is nearby. Hotel Rooms: 6
